After nearly 35 years, Fat Head’s Saloon on the South Side is closing down for good.
The announcement was made on social media Tuesday afternoon.
“Closing the doors is incredibly difficult, but we do it with pride, gratitude, and a lifetime of memories,” Fat Heads said in a message.
No reason was immediately given for the closing.
The last day of operations for Fat Heads on Carson Street will be April 26.
“Between now and then, we hope you’ll stop in, raise a glass, say hello, and share a store or two with us.”
A “Last Call” gathering is also planned for Friday, April 17.
“A farewell, in a way, for former employees, longtime regulars, and friends of Fat Head’s to stop by, reconnect, and celebrate the many years we shared together. One last round before the lights come on,” the message reads.
Fat Head’s Beer will continue to be available at retailers around Pittsburgh.
Fat Heads beer is brewed in Ohio.
